Two metal complexes of 1,4,7-triazacyclodecane ( tacd ), [Zn( tacd )2] (ClO4)2 (1) and [Cu( tacd )2] Br2.4H2O (2), have been prepared and characterized by X-ray crystallography. Crystals of (1) are monoclinic, P21/n, a 9.506(2), b 10.279(3), c 11.505(2) Ǻ, β 91.29(2)°; crystals of (2) are orthorhombic, Pbca, a 12.035(3), b 13.673(3), c 14.248(2) Ǻ. The zinc(II) atom in (1) is surrounded in a distorted octahedral N6 environment with Zn-N bonds at 2.121(5)-2.131(4) Ǻ; the copper(II) atom in (2) adopts an elongated octahedral coordination geometry with the Cu-N bonds at 2.066(4)-2.294(5) Ǻ.
